Bulletstorm is an FPS developed by People Can Fly and Epic Games.

The game is set in the 26th century, where the universe is run by the Confederation. The player controls the commander of a black ops unit Grayson Hunt who went rogue after realizing that the unit was tricked into killing civilians by its' superior, General Sarrano. 10 years pass when Grayson and his team come across Sarrano's cruiser, attempt to destroy it and crash land on a surface of a planet called Stygia which used to be a tropical-like resort.

The game focuses heavily on combat and features a scoring system named Skillshot. Players gain points for every kill, the more creative the murder is - the more points one gets. Environmental kills are valued the most. Points are used as currency that can be used to upgrade your weapons, buy new ones or get ammunition.

Players can carry three weapons with the assault rifle being the default one and can always be found in one's inventory.

There is no competitive multiplayer in Bulletstorm, but co-op and score attack modes are available.

On release, the developers made fun of other games in the marketing campaign. The dark humor was one of the defining aspects of Bulletstorm.

Bulletstorm is a 2011 first-person shooter game developed by People Can Fly and Epic Games and published by Electronic Arts (EA). The video game is distinguished by its system of rewarding players with "skillpoints" for performing increasingly creative kills. Bulletstorm does not have any competitive multiplayer modes, preferring instead to include cooperative online play and score attack modes. Set in the 26th century, the game's story follows Grayson Hunt, a space pirate and former black ops soldier who gets shot down on a war-torn planet while trying to exact revenge on General Sarrano, his former commander who tricked him and his men into committing war crimes and assassinating innocents.
